Alma Ritter is a dedicated fifth-grade math and science teacher at Lincoln Elementary School. She is a graduate from Kutztown University.
Outside the classroom, Mrs. Ritter shares her leadership skills as the director of Lincoln's annual school musical. She also shares her love of nature with her students by running the Trout in the Classroom program and a Fish Keepers Club after school so fourth and fifth graders can learn about properly caring for an aquarium.
When she's not teaching, Mrs. Ritter enjoys working in her aquariums and spending time with her family camping or fishing. She also enjoys geocaching and exploring new places with her family.
